Why study in Oulu?
Oulu is a city in northern Finland, and is one of the world’s most northerly cities. It is known as a high-tech city, with free wireless internet access, and is home to a number of Finnish IT companies, including Nokia. Oulu is also a popular student city, with several universities, colleges and schools.
The city offers students plenty of cultural attractions, including music concerts, museums and the world famous Air Guitar World Championships. Due to its location, Oulu has a cold climate, with very short summers and an average annual temperature of just 37°F. The city has its own airport which flies to Helsinki and Stockholm, and a railway station that connects Oulu to other major Finnish cities.

Universities in Oulu
There are two universities with their main campus in Oulu, the University of Oulu and Oulu University of Applied Sciences. Both universities are located near the center of the city but also have campuses with many amenities.
What to study in Oulu
Oulu's University of Applied Sciences offers students the ability to gain practical experience in a variety of subjects including biology and chemistry. The University of Oulu has master's taught in English in a variety of popular subjects such as business and engineering.

How to study in Oulu
When you've found a program you want to study in Oulu you'll need to ensure you meet any requirements before applying, including English language proficiency tests.
All international students whether EU citizens or not will need to apply for a Finnish residence permit to study in Oulu for more than three months. Those from outside the EU will also need to apply for a visa when they have accepted an offer to study.
Cost to study in Oulu
The exact cost of tuition in Oulu will depend on your program, but like the rest of Finland will range between $5,000 and $16,000.
International students in Oulu will pay less for living costs than those in larger cities such as Helsinki. This is especially the case with rent, where monthly accommodation costs can be up to 40% cheaper.
